Job Summary:

The Program Manager will be responsible for successfully planning, organizing, and motivating a diverse program team throughout development and delivery process including all phases of projects, and for delivery management. The Program Manager provides leadership and direction to a team responsible for delivering efficient and effective technology initiatives to users. This role ensures all programs are executed in alignment with Tolling’s technology strategy. The Program Manager oversees the development and support of EZPass applications, including implementing application solutions and resolving support tickets. Key operational responsibilities include direct oversight of team performance, promoting continuous improvement, collaborating with peer Program Managers, and planning and executing broader EZPass initiatives. The program delivers services across the full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).
